## v2.8.1 — Prosewright

Fixed the rule that flagged perfectly fine admonition blocks as orphaned headings (sorry about the noisy weekend). Also bumped the parser so nested tables stop crashing the linter on Windows runners. If Prosewright starts spamming false positives again, roll back to 2.8.0 and ping the maintainer. The person to wake up for anything worse is listed below.

named custodian: Oliath Ralax

## Greenhouse controller: sensor drift provenance

Humidity drift on Vervain Ridge units traces to firmware batches compiled before the calibration patch. Support should not swap hardware first; check the firmware lineage. Drift above 4% over 48 hours means the unit shipped with the pre-patch build. Recalibration via the field app resolves most cases. The last known-good firmware token is noted below.

trace token, fafof-tajef: htk9_849b0fd88

Handover for tonight's shift: the Brightmoor cleaning crew arrives around 23:30 and works floors two through five until roughly 03:00. Please check their names against the roster folder at the desk before letting them through. Their supervisor carries a company letter but no building badge this week, as theirs are being reissued. Log their entry and exit times as usual. To admit them through the loading-bay door, use the access code below.

door code, yagap-bahof: bdg-O-05

Test Plan — ChipGate Reader v2.4 (Harborfell Marathon)

Scope: verify the ChipGate mat reader ingests split times under peak load of 1,200 runners per minute. We'll replay last season's capture from the Renwick Bridge checkpoint and compare against the timing ledger. Pass criteria: zero dropped reads, latency under 300 ms, clean failover to the backup antenna. QA runs start Tuesday; results go to the release channel by Friday. The staging ingest endpoint authenticates each replay session with the token below.

session JWT of yawep-yawep = eyJhbGciOiJIUzI1NiIsInR5cCI6IkpXVCJ9.eyJzdWIiOiI3pWF3_In0.aXYsHiog